Before you played the Small Town Operators, your previous 2 games attendance were 16877 and 16926. Lets say the average was 16900, then you played an undefeated STO and saw your attendance spike to 19176. Thats a difference of nearly 2300. Now your playing a team that has only won 1 game, and your attendance has dropped 14482. Thats a drop of 2400.

Seems right to me, your baseline is 16900. You play a good team, you get a 2300 bump. You play a lousy team, you see a drop nearly equal to that at 2400.

All is right in the world.

Private League games are not like regular games. That is a fact. You must be new here too, or to lazy to do your own research.

What is affected by Private Leagues?
Everything from outside the private league affects the league, but nothing from inside the private league affects the outside. What this means is that enthusiasm levels, injuries and game shape will be considered when playing your private league match. However, nothing that happens in the private league match will be used for your team. So enthusiasm won’t be affected, you don’t get any income for winning or playing at home, your country and world ranking isn’t affected and it will not count towards minutes played for the week. This means that it doesn’t affect game shape and minutes played do not count towards training. Players can be injured during a private league match; however, as soon as that match is over the injuries will not carry over to the league.
